Patrick McHardy wrote:
> These patches fix all drivers supporting VLAN header stripping to
> pass the complete VLAN TCI to vlan_hwaccel_{rx,receive_skb} instead
> of just the VID. The upper three bits contain the priority and are
> used for ingress priority mappings.
> 
> The e1000 patch is runtime tested, the others only compile tested.

Acked-by: Jeff Garzik <jgarzik@redhat.com>

Though I would suggest combining all these patches into a single patch, 
since they constitute a single logical change, and each change is 
self-contained and small.
